#baf3f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#baf3fe is composed of 72.9% red, 95.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 189.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 86.3%. #baf3f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75e7fd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#baf3f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#baf3fe has RGB values of R:186, G:243,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12252158.

Shades and Tints of #baf3f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000708 is the darkest color, while #f4f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#baf3f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#daddde is the less saturated color, while #baf3fe is the most saturated one.
